Caterpillar (NYSE:CAT -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, April 30th. The industrial products company reported $4.25 E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$4.35 by ($0.10). The firm had revenue of $14.25 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$14.64 billion. Caterpillar had a net margin of 15.71% and a return on equity of 53.77%. The firm's quarterly revenue was down 9.8%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period last year, the business posted $5.60 earnings per share. Analysts expect that Caterpillar Inc. will post 19.86 earnings per share for the current year.
Caterpillar Increases Dividend
The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, August 20th. Stockholders of record on Monday, July 21st will be paid a $1.51 dividend. This is a boost from Caterpillar's previous quarterly dividend of $1.41. This represents a $6.04 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 1.38%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Monday, July 21st. Caterpillar's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 29.43%.

About Caterpillar
(
Free Report)
Caterpillar Inc manufactures and sells construction and mining equipment, off-highway diesel and natural gas engines, industrial gas turbines, and diesel-electric locomotives in worldwide. Its Construction Industries segment offers asphalt pavers, compactors, road reclaimers, forestry machines, cold planers, material handlers, track-type tractors, excavators, telehandlers, motor graders, and pipelayers; compact track, wheel, track-type, backhoe, and skid steer loaders; and related parts and tools.
